What Actually Is Home Remodeling?
Home remodeling encompasses altering, improving, or rebuilding existing spaces within a home. Unlike simple repairs, which address damage or wear, remodeling deliberately redesigns the purpose and character of a space. This can mean replacing outdated systems like plumbing and electrical — or work as specific as replacing flooring throughout a level of the home.
Mechanically, home remodeling follows a structured sequence. It typically begins with design and planning, moves through selective removal of walls, fixtures, or finishes, and then progresses into rough work. After inspections pass, the project transitions to what homeowners actually see: flooring, fixtures, hardware, and lighting.
The scale and detail of home remodeling vary enormously depending on the age of the home. Older homes in mature residential communities often need extra attention around lead paint remediation or plumbing upgrades. A seasoned remodeling team will flag potential complications before breaking get more info ground so they don't become costly surprises.

The Home Remodeling Process Step by Step
- The First Conversation About Your Project — All great home remodeling project begins with a thorough discovery meeting. Our team at Brother & Brother Builders sits down with you to learn what you want to achieve. This session surfaces everything we need to build a project scope from the first interaction.
- The Design and Documentation Phase — Once goals are clear, our planning team develop detailed drawings based on your input and the site conditions. This stage also handles all necessary regulatory submissions to local authorities, ensuring no shortcuts are taken with approvals.
- Teardown and Prep Work — Remodeling cannot begin until existing materials are carefully removed. Our workers protects surrounding areas with dust barriers to minimize disruption to your daily routine. Selective removal is handled carefully — not touching a single thing that isn't scheduled for replacement.
- Structural and Systems Rough-In Work — Once the slate is clean, load-bearing adjustments happen before anything else. Then credentialed trade professionals run new lines in line with permit requirements. Inspections occur at key milestones to sign off on each phase before insulation and drywall go in.
- Closing Up the Walls — After rough-in inspections pass, the building envelope is addressed for energy performance and sound control. Moisture barriers are placed wherever water contact is expected, and the walls are closed up to establish the foundation for tile, paint, and cabinetry.
- The Part Homeowners See — This stage marks the moment the home remodeling work becomes visible and exciting. Fixtures, hardware, millwork, and paint go in with careful attention to detail. Home Remodeling Frequently Asked Questions
How long does a typical home remodeling project take?
Project length differs considerably based on how much of the home is being changed. A single-room update might take six to ten weeks from start to finish. Large-scale renovations may extend beyond a year depending on the complexity of structural work and trade scheduling. Our team provides realistic timelines before work kicks off.
What does home remodeling typically cost in San Jose?
Pricing depends on many factors depending on square footage, structural changes, and design choices. In this region, a standard kitchen renovation can fall anywhere from $30,000 to $120,000 while bathroom renovations typically range from $12,000 to $60,000. The initial meeting always include a ballpark estimate so you can plan accordingly.
Will I need to move out during home remodeling?
Your ability to remain on-site during a remodel depends entirely on the location and scope of active construction. Targeted single-room projects frequently let families remain in the house. Full-home remodels frequently benefit from the homeowners stepping out. The project managers at our office address living arrangements during the initial consultation.
How long will home remodeling results last?
With quality workmanship, home remodeling results are built to last decades. Investing in good finishes and proper technique makes an enormous difference. Kitchens and bathrooms executed by licensed, experienced contractors routinely serve homeowners well for twenty to thirty years or more.
Do I need permits for home remodeling in San Jose?
With nearly all meaningful renovation work, yes — permits are required for anything that alters load-bearing elements, utility systems, or the building envelope. Pulling permits protects you as a homeowner and makes certain inspections verify the quality.
